Hi Marek — handing over the soft-delete migration on the Cartwheel orders table. The deleted_at column is live, but three batch jobs still filter on status='removed', so both paths coexist until Thursday. The backfill script ran clean in staging; prod run is scheduled for tonight at 02:00. Review notes are in the PR description. If the backfill stalls, ping the data platform desk.

pager mailbox: druwyn@norvaio.corp

Subject: Handover — validator plugin stuff

Hey Priya,

Passing you the baton on Checkwright, our plugin system for data validators. The new schema-drift plugin shipped Tuesday and mostly behaves, but it occasionally flags empty CSV uploads as "malformed" — harmless, just noisy. I've muted the alert until Friday. If support escalates anything about plugin load failures, the fix is usually bumping the registry cache. Questions after I'm off? Reach the Checkwright maintainers at the address below.

billing contact of hawip-kahif = zorwyn@tolvaqlabs.corp

Proseguard runs on every docs pull request and flags broken cross-references, stale version strings, and banned terminology. When reviewing rule changes, confirm that new rules include at least three positive and three negative test fixtures, and that severity levels match the published style guide rather than the author's preference. Rules marked autofix need extra scrutiny, since a bad rewrite ships silently. The rule catalog, fixture conventions, and exemption process are all on the internal page here.

operations page: https://jenkins.zemvarcloud.local/job/merge_requests/repo/build/73930b4b30f0a8ed

Ticket FARE-412: Vault lockout blocking shipping-fees rules engine deploy. The Tariffwright rules engine cannot fetch its rate-table secrets because the Coffervault instance sealed itself after three failed unseal attempts during last night's maintenance window at the Bramblehurst site. All fee calculations are currently falling back to cached tariffs, which expire at midnight. Release of version 4.2 should hold until the vault is reopened and the zone-surcharge rules are re-validated. To unseal, use the recovery passphrase below.

recovery phrase for fawif-tajeg: norael-aldmir-casir-brivan-ulaion